Vittorio Monti was born on January 6, 1868 in Naples (Italy). His musical education (violin and composition), he enjoyed at the conservatory there. Around his 30's Monti went to Paris. He earned a living as a conductor and wrote several ballets and operettas. In his last years, Monti died in 1922, he devoted himself to teaching and composing. His famous "Czardas" has made his name known even today. Initially the czardas was a Hungarian folk dance , but after the mid-nineteenth century it was even a dance for the upper-class. Czardas begins with a slow introduction, the Lassan (slow and sad), and then the fast part, Friska, follows. Czardas is not, as so many people think typical gypsy music.Duration: 5.30

Monti's virtuosic showpiece for the violin has long been a favourite. This arrangement, made especially for euphonium star Robert Childs, gives the soloist the opportunity to display the full range of technical and musical skills, whether in the rich, lugubrious slow introduction or in the bustling allegro vivace which follows.
